Celebrating Staff LogoEvery week we celebrate SMCDSB staff members who have been recognized by a parent, student or colleague.

This week we are celebrating Nicole Morris-Palma, an Nicole Morris-Palma elementary curriculum consultant at Academic Services. Nicole was nominated by a colleague, who said:

“Nicole has been a wonderful help during my transition as a teacher. She has gone above and beyond her duties as a consultant and has provided me with many wonderful resources. She has been very supportive and kind, and my class loves it when she comes to visit! Thank you so much for all that you do!”

Shelley SalisburyThis week we are also celebrating Shelley Salisbury, a teacher at Sister Catherine Donnelly Catholic School. Shelley was nominated by a colleague, who said:

“Shelley has taken the time to recognize a need in our community by staying current with local news and has subsequently provided an opportunity for her students to make a REAL impact in the local community - beyond the school. Recognizing the need of the Salvation Army in providing hot meals to members of our local community, Shelley's students are taking part in the preparation and packing of meals that are picked up at the school on a monthly basis. She is taking her own time to provide an opportunity for students to be witnesses to their faith by being charitable with their time. She has provided a REAL learning opportunity that is not about personal achievement but rather about uplifting others.”

We would like to thank Nicole and Shelley for their commitment to Catholic education at our board.
